Falling Snow

Day 208 on 365 Card Challenge, has introduced the theme - Imagine This - Falling Snow -whatever this makes you think of, let it inspire your card design.

Well, living in Michigan - Falling Snow makes me thing of bare trees, snowflakes, and lots of snowmen being built. Michigan is truly a Winter Wonderland - especially at Christmas time. So much to do during this season and even though I do not care for COLD weather, it truly is a wonderful adventure to take a night drive and see all of the colorful lights, lawn decorations, and the beautiful snow and snowmen during this time of year in Pure Michigan.

For this card, I used the following items:
1. Pre-made DCWV black card
2. Cricut Cartridge- A Child's Year - snowman with child, shovel, bird cut at 3 1/2 inches using Colorbok white card-stock
3. Tim Holtz - Branch Tree with The Paper Company brown card-stock
4. Martha Stewart inks for the child's outerwear, snowman nose, bird, and shovel
5. Friskers small snowflake punch
6. Forever in Time Pop-dots for the snow scene
7. Scotch brand adhesive for the snowflakes/tree

Snowman Card 1

Snowman Cricut Cartridge Card - Supplies used: (Gypsy)
1. A Child's Year Circut Cartridge - cut at 3.5 inches - white card stock by Colorbox - embossed with Cuttlebug Swiss Dot Embossing Folder
2. Shadow cut - TPC Studio Sweet Celebrations You Take The Cake Card-stock - cut at 3.5
3. Tree Die Cut - Tim Holtz Branch Tree - embossed with Cuttlebug Forest Branches Embossing folder
4. Snowflake (Corner Embellishment)- Tim Holtz Winter Wonderland Die Cut
5. Card - DCWV
6. ATG/Tape and Scotch Brand Quick Dry Adhesive
7. Pop Dot by Forever In Time for the Snowman Cut
8. Rhinestone for the snowflake by Recollections
